The availability of a distance education B.P.Ed. at Cheran College of Physical Education depends on the college's current approvals and programme offerings. Since B.P.Ed. is a professional, practice-oriented programme involving physical training, teaching practice, and internships, it is generally offered in regular mode rather than through distance education. Candidates should verify the latest information with the college or the relevant regulatory authorities before applying. IIT Dharwad MSc Physics cutoff 2026 was 767 for the General AI category in the third round. The IIT Dharwad MSc cutoff 2026 has been released up to round 3 for admission to the MSc in Physics and other branches.
See the list below to know the round 3 cutoff for all other categories.
- OBC: 1272
- SC: 2401
- ST: 4488
- EWS:1261

The IIT Indore MSc cutoff 2026 was released till round 3 for various All India quota categories. For the MSc in Physics course, the cutoff (Round 1 to Round 3) ranged from 420 to 420 for the General AI category.
Students can see the table below to know the IIT Indore MSc cutoff 2026 for different All India categories.
| Category | IIT Indore MSc cutoff range 2026 (Round 1 to Round 3) |
|---|---|
| General | 420 - 420 |
| OBC | 667 - 805 |
| SC | 1674 - 2110 |
| ST | 2949 - 3322 |
| EWS | 699 - 734 |

Eligibility Criteria for BSc in Basic Sciences are mentioned in the following table:
BSc Course | Eligibility |
|---|---|
BSc Physics | Minimum 50% aggregate in Class 12 exam or equivalent exam with Physics as one of the subjects. |
BSc Chemistry | Minimum 50% aggregate in Class 12 in Science Stream with Chemistry, Physics and Mathematics/ Biology/ Computer Science / Informatics Practices/ Information Technology as compulsory subjects. |
BSc Mathematics | Minimum 50% aggregate in Class 12 exam or equivalent exam with Mathematics as one of the subjects. |

MGM School of Biomedical Sciences, MGM Institute of Health Sciences has world-class infrastructure available for MSc Medical Physics such as:
- Medical Linear Accelerators
- Diagnostic Imaging Departments
- Advanced Radiotherapy Facilities
- Radiation Dosimetry and QA Laboratories
- Multi-specialty Teaching Hospital Exposure
- CT Simulator and Treatment Planning Systems

After completing MSc Medical Physics from MGM School of Biomedical Sciences, MGM Institute of Health Sciences, students can build their career as Radiation Safety Officer, QA / Dosimetry Physicist, Medical Physicist (Radiotherapy), Research Scientist, and as part of medical equipment companies and healthcare technology firms.
